Can matlab append figures to an existing pdf file learn more about saveas, pdf, append. However, to do this, both the vectors should have same number of elements. Matlab det matematisknaturvitenskapelige fakultet, uio. Residual errors themselves form a time series that can have temporal structure. With a little scripting, cleaning up documentation and other large sets of html files can be easy. Adding an element to an array can be achieved using indexing or concatenation.
A complete python tutorial from scratch in data science. Contents 1 setting up 3 2 quickstart tutorial 7 3 numpy basics 31 4 miscellaneous 95 5 numpy for matlab users 101 6 building from source 109 7 using numpy capi 1. Writing the code for the gui callbacks matlab automatically generates an. Matlab language iterate over columns of matrix rip tutorial.
How to model residual errors to correct time series forecasts. Using matlabs handle graphics system, it is possible if tedious to design each print page in detail, arrange elements, etc. Hi there, i have a for loop that creates an 10x10 vector in each iteration. In the training, we were talking about exporting figures to various formats, and one of the attendees wanted to export them as multipage pdfs.
The numpy module provides a ndarray object using which we can use to perform operations on an array of any dimension. So was wondering if a matlab figure can be added to a specific page of the existing pdf file. Mar 30, 2015 while the standard picamera module provides methods to interface with the camera, we need the optional array submodule so that we can utilize opencv. Dec 22, 2017 generating pdf file format in clientside javascript is now trivial with a great library we have probably heard of. Append pdfs in matlab download free open source matlab. How to export data from simulink to matlab and how to work with time series structure duration. Read data on more patients from a commadelimited file, morepatients. R is similar to the awardwinning 1 s system, which was developed at bell laboratories by john chambers et al. Save a figure as pdf matlab answers matlab central. Xx is the serial number of the figure, which i need to merge to make a single pdf file.
Convert htmlcss content to a sleek multiple page pdf file. Using this model we were able to detect and localize. There are already tons of tutorials on how to make basic plots in matplotlib. If used within matrix definitions it indicates the end of a row. Rearrange individual pages or entire files in the desired order. Python determines the type of the reference automatically based on the data object assigned to it. Matlab i about the tutorial matlab is a programming language developed by mathworks. For example, using the graph from the previous example, add an x and yaxis labels. However, it is essentially the same as algorithms previously published by bernard roy in 1959 and also by stephen warshall in 1962 for finding the transitive closure of a graph, and is closely related to kleenes algorithm. Merging pdf without ghostscript matlab answers matlab central. The output variable contains three different string values. If you have two row vectors r1 and r2 with n and m number of elements, to create a row vector r of n plus m elements, by appending these vectors, you write.
The ndarray stands for ndimensional array where n is any number. It also has an option for exporting multipage postscript files. If you are looking for more control in terms of how the different figures are combined, another solution is to use pdflatex to compile the figures into a. Acklam statistics division department of mathematics. Appending two datasets require that both have variables with exactly the same name. A few weeks ago i showed you how to perform text detection using opencvs east deep learning model. Plotly supports png, svg, jpg, and pdf image export. Binding a variable in python means setting a name to hold a reference to some object. This is an introduction to r gnu s, a language and environment for statistical computing and graphics.
No part of this manual may be photocopied or repro duced in any form. First of all, when you will open your matlab software then, the first window opened will look like as shown in the image below. Using matlabs publish command is a great solution, as other answers have pointed out. Numpy has a number of advantages over the python lists. Hi all, is it possible to merge pdfs in matlab without using ghostscript. How to merge multiple jpeg or pdf files to a single pdf.
Exporting generic htmlcss to pdf has been an open question without a definitive answer for quite a long time. The mathworks company manufactures the most comprehensive computer computing software. For example, if your plot has two lines, but only one of them has a legend entry and that should stay this way, then adding a third line with a legend entry can be difficult. The floydwarshall algorithm is an example of dynamic programming, and was published in its currently recognized form by robert floyd in 1962. This tutorial is aimed at beginners and novices to matlab r who also want to be good programmers. This function appends multiple pdf files to an existing pdf file, or concatenates them into a pdf file if the output file doesnt yet exist. How to export plotly graphs as static images in matlab. Using numpy, mathematical and logical operations on arrays can be performed. In r2015b, matlab changed how pdfs are generated, so these entries dont.
This is the simple workspace of matlab, now in order to open thegui toolbar, you have to write guide in the workspace as i did below after writing the guide in command window, hit enter and a new small window will open up. Matlab cheat sheet basic commands % indicates rest of line is commented out if used at end of command it suppresses output. If using categorical data make sure the categories on both datasets refer to exactly the same thing i. Sep 17, 2018 in this tutorial, you will learn how to apply opencv ocr optical character recognition. Output files are lineoriented text files which makes it possible to process them with a variety of tools and programming languages as well, including matlab, gnu r, perl, python, and spreadsheet programs. Placing plots into multiple page pdf document matlab. It is particularly important to familiarize yourself with the user interface and some basic functionality of matlab. With knowledge of wi, we can maximize the likelihod to find similarly, given wi, we can calculate what. This can be much faster than appending pdfs one at at time.
Theres even a huge example plot gallery right on the matplotlib web site, so im not going to bother covering the basics here. Text to append to document, specified as a string or character vector. Numpy i about the tutorial numpy, which stands for numerical python, is a library consisting of multidimensional array objects and a collection of routines for processing those arrays. Expectation maximizatio em algorithm computational. I want to insert at the end number of raws with same elements such as 5 5 5 and make the matrix 10 x 3 i. About the tutorial matlab is a programming language developed by mathworks. Its from one of our regular matlab central and matlab user, oliver, whom many of you may know. So the basic idea behind expectation maximization em is simply to start with a guess for. The print function has an option for exporting a figure as a singlepage pdf.
Follow 2,550 views last 30 days john on 7 jan 2014. When you save this file, matlab automatically generates two files. When modeling multiclass classification problems using neural networks, it is good practice to reshape the output attribute from a vector that contains values for each class value to be a matrix with a boolean for each class value and whether or not a given instance has that class value or not. I know append can be used to add figure to existing pdf file but the problem is every time i mess up with the sequence of figures i have to redo all the figures in one pdf again. As we mentioned earlier, the following tutorial lessons are designed to get you started quickly in matlab. I realized that many postings there were about how to ma. Nonetype object has no attribute append a b1,2,3,4 a a. Similarly, you can append two column vectors c1 and c2 with n and m number of elements. You can use print with the append option to write multiple pages to a postscript file in sequence, and then convert the ps to pdf. The library allows you to select the dom document object model elements that you wish to publish as pdf content.
Lets import matplotlibs functionbased interface import matplotlib. For the love of physics walter lewin may 16, 2011 duration. What behavior do you expect that you are not seeing. As a longtime member of the documentation team at scribus, i keep uptodate with the latest updates of the source so i can help make updates and additions to the. Assignment creates references, not copies names in python do not have an intrinsic type. Creating multipage pdfs file exchange pick of the week. This tutorial explains the basics of numpy such as its architecture and environment. To accomplish that, this tutorial explains many of the computer science concepts behind programming in matlab. The following matlab project contains the source code and matlab examples used for append pdfs. This file was selected as matlab central pick of the week. For character array inputs, strcat removes trailing ascii whitespace characters.
I have a function called details, where the user enters his name, and the details are stored in the array, say name. How to make beautiful data visualizations in python with. Matlab saving multiple figures to a pdf stack overflow. And theres no need to change a single line of your code. In this tutorial, we will take bite sized information about how to use python for data analysis, chew it till we are comfortable and practice it at our own end. Matlab runs your code almost twice as fast as it did just four years ago. It provides a wide variety of statistical and graphical techniques linear and nonlinear modelling. A python package which emulates matlab functionality well documented at.
It was originally designed for solving linear algebra type problems using matrices. This tutorial gives you aggressively a gentle introduction of matlab programming language. How to add elements to a list matlab answers matlab. Placing plots into multiple page pdf document matlab answers. Is it possible to add a matlab figure to a specific page of the existing pdf. Jun 28, 2014 this time, im going to focus on how you can make beautiful data visualizations in python with matplotlib. Then, append the rows from t2 to the end of the table, t. Matlab allows you to append vectors together to create new vectors. My question is how can i append each 10x10 vector underneath each other after each iteration. Matlab matrix laboratory is a multiparadigm numerical computing environment and fourthgeneration programming language which is frequently being used by engineering and science students. Remember, when using python bindings, opencv represents images as numpy arrays and the array submodule allows us to obtain numpy arrays from the raspberry pi camera module. The text object is wrapped in a paragraph object and the paragraph is appended to the document. A simple autoregression model of this structure can be used to predict the forecast error, which in turn can be used to correct forecasts. Introduction to matlab for engineering students northwestern.
The residual errors from forecasts on a time series provide another source of information that we can model. It can be run both under interactive sessions and as a batch job. It started out as a matrix programming language where linear algebra programming was simple. Data management workspace variables save filename, variables saves workspace variables to a file filename. Savingreading binary files and making calls to the operating system when using matlab, either when running a mfile or performing calculations interactively, there is a master memory structure that matlab uses to keep track of. Documentation tutorials examples videos and webinars training. Learning programming using matlab free download as pdf file. So, if we want to use numpy, it must be imported separately. Jan 14, 2016 due to lack of resource on python for data science, i decided to create this tutorial to help many others to learn python faster. We can perform high performance operations on the numpy.
Matlab advantages great ide matlab desktop can do a lot with plotting usually you can get access if you are at a university lots of online support dynamic language matlab disadvantages expensive licensed, so its closed source 1120 14 6. You can also create a matrix r by appending these two vectors, the vector r2, will be the second row of the matrix. This video will show you the basics and give you an idea of what working in matlab looks like. Matlab tutorial, march 26, 2004 j gadewadikar, automation and robotics research institute university of texas at arlington 36 how to explore it more. Ofdm tutorial matlab orthogonal frequency division. Matlab matlab is a software package for doing numerical computation. The pdf portable document format version was created with ps2pdf, a part of aladdin ghost. We urge you to complete the exercises given at the end of each lesson. The lessons are intended to make you familiar with the basics of matlab. While you read through this tutorial, there will be many examples.
Opencv ocr and text recognition with tesseract pyimagesearch. Late reply, but i thought id add that you could use the publish command and publish to pdf. Matlab tutorial this tutorial series introduces you to the matlabr2006b suite of applications from mathworks, inc. Append rows at the end of matrix matlab answers matlab. I would like to create a big matrix or structure containing all the variables, in which every day i can append the new obtained values without deleting the prior ones. If the righthand side of the assignment is a matrix, then in each iteration the variable is assigned subsequent columns of this matrix. Each day i run my matlab routine, in order to save the measurements and calculate new variables e.
Learning programming using matlab matlab computer program. The table, t, has 100 rows and eight variables columns. If you want to do it only occasionally, then you can use the matlab figure window to export to pdf, and the pdfsam gui to merge them into a single pdf. Goal of this chapter the primary goal of this chapter is to help you to become familiar with the matlabw software, a powerful tool. Multiclass classification tutorial with the keras deep.
679 692 545 602 696 624 319 484 638 1098 199 818 1567 39 1063 1106 55 573 1504 1430 688 44 618 479 1123 528 1091 48 837 169 197 1080 1417 2 584